    1. Market Estimation & Definition
    Marine urea is a non-toxic, colorless solution consisting of urea and deionized water, specifically formulated for use in SCR systems onboard ships. When injected into exhaust streams, marine urea reacts with nitrogen oxides, converting them into harmless nitrogen and water vapor. The marine urea market includes production, distribution, and consumption across commercial vessels, cargo ships, tankers, cruise liners, and offshore support vessels. Market expansion is closely linked to rising global maritime trade, fleet modernization, and the enforcement of emission reduction mandates.

    Market Definition & Overview
    “Marine urea” refers to high‑purity urea supplied to the maritime industry as a reagent for selective catalytic reduction (SCR) systems and exhaust‑gas after‑treatment aboard ships. In marine SCR systems, urea (typically as aqueous urea solution, often known by the trade name “DEF” or “AdBlue” / “AUS 32” in road‑vehicle context) is injected into exhaust streams to convert nitrogen oxides (NOₓ) in ship emissions into harmless nitrogen and water, helping vessels meet stringent environmental and emissions regulations.

    The global marine urea market therefore encompasses production, distribution, and supply of marine‑grade urea solution; logistics and bunkering infrastructure (ports supplying urea); and demand from shipping companies, ship‑owners, and ship‑builders installing or retrofitting SCR after‑treatment systems.

    With tightening maritime emissions regulations worldwide, especially for sulfur oxides (SOₓ), NOₓ and other pollutants, marine urea has emerged as a critical commodity to comply with environmental standards — making the market increasingly central to the future of shipping and marine transport.

    Market Overview

    The global marine interiors market is experiencing significant growth, driven by increasing demand for passenger comfort, luxury yachts, and cruise ships. The market encompasses various interior components such as ceilings and wall panels, lighting, galleys and pantries, furniture, and other elements that enhance the aesthetic and functional aspects of marine vessels.

    Market Size and Forecast

    According to recent industry reports, the marine interiors market was valued at approximately USD 3.67 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 8.64 billion by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.3%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2032. This growth is attributed to the rising demand for cruise ships and luxury yachts, which require high-quality interior solutions to meet passenger expectations.
